[QUOTE]Originally posted by jgrecoconstr: [QB] ROCKVILLE, Maryland, December 19 /PRNewswire/ -- Neuralstem, Inc. (NYSE Alternext US: CUR) announced this morning that it has filed an Investigational New Drug (IND) application with the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) to begin a clinical trial to treat am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S or Lou Gehrig's disease).
